#P1423. Big Number

Big Number

描述

在许多应用中,需要处理非常大的整数。例如,某些应用使用密钥进行数据的安全传输、加密等。在这个问题中,给定一个数字,你需要计算该数字的阶乘的位数。

输入

输入包含多行整数。第一行是一个整数nn,表示测试用例的数量。接下来的nn行,每行包含一个整数1m1071 \leq m \leq 10^7

输出

对于输入中的每个整数,输出其阶乘的位数。

输入样例 1

2  
10  
20

输出样例 1

7  
19

来源
达卡 2002